NVIDIA GeForce 940MX vs AMD Radeon RX 6700M

We compared two Mobile platform GPUs: 2GB VRAM GeForce 940MX and 10GB VRAM Radeon RX 6700M to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A GeForce 940MX 's Advantages
Lower TDP (23W vs 135W)
AMD Radeon RX 6700M 's Advantages
Released 5 years and 4 months late
Boost Clock has increased by 93% (2400MHz vs 1242MHz)
More VRAM (10GB vs 2GB)
Larger VRAM bandwidth (320.0GB/s vs 16.02GB/s)
1920 additional rendering cores
